Web2.2 Using render. In most cases, the ActionController::Base#render method does the heavy lifting of rendering your application's content for use by a browser. There are a variety of ways to customize the behavior of render.You can render the default view for a Rails template, or a specific template, or a file, or inline code, or nothing at all. WebTo render a template you can use the render_template() method. All you have to do is provide the name of the template and the variables you want to pass to the template engine as keyword arguments. Here’s a simple example of how to render a template: ...
